About
- Laura is an experienced litigator focused on environmental, Aboriginal and administrative law
- She provides advice to clients in a range of industries including infrastructure, energy, mining, agriculture, forestry and real estate
- In her environmental law practice, Laura helps clients successfully navigate project approvals, including environmental assessment and project permitting
- She also advises clients with respect to contaminated sites, assists with transactional due diligence involving environmental considerations, and advises clients in relation to environmental disclosure obligations
- Laura brings a strategic and practical approach to environmental issues and assists clients to identify risks and manage them to a successful outcome
- In relation to Aboriginal law, Laura assists clients with respect to consultation and engagement with Indigenous communities and the negotiation of relationship and impact benefit agreements
- Laura also has extensive experience with litigation involving Aboriginal law issues
- Laura has appeared before all levels of court in British Columbia and the Federal Court of Canada
- She also has extensive tribunal hearing experience, and regularly appears before various administrative bodies including the Environmental Appeal Board, the BC Energy Regulator and environmental review panels
- In addition to appearing before courts and tribunals, Laura assists clients in resolving their disputes using alternative dispute resolution processes, including arbitration and mediation
